Gun shot detectors coming to an American city near you

Gunshots ring out in the dead of night, and not a single person reports it. Yet police know exactly where the shots came from, even before they arrive on the scene.
It sounds like a scene from The Minority Report, but it's real. A new technology called ShotSpotter enables law enforcement officials to precisely and instantaneously locate shooters, and it has been quietly rolling out across America. From Long Island, N.Y., to San Francisco, Calif., more than 60 cities in the U.S. have been leveraging ShotSpotter to make their streets safer. . . .
“If You Fire a Gun, We Will Find You.”
ShotSpotter relies on wide-area acoustic surveillance and GPS technology to triangulate the source of gunshots. Sensors are fixed to buildings and poles to provide coverage over a fixed area. With audio-analysis software, it can identify whether a shooter is stationary or moving -- meaning police officers can be equipped with information on the speed and direction of, say, a vehicle from which a shot was fired.
It can also “hear” the acoustic signature and distinguish between calibers and types of firearms. Similarly, it can hear different explosions and classify them, from vehicle backfires to fireworks to bombs.
The ShotSpotter Gunfire Alert system then relays the location and data to the police or a dispatch computer within moments, enabling a more rapid response time for both police and first responders.
The best part: ShotSpotter works. It's accurate to 10 to 15 feet, and some police departments are reporting accuracy to within five feet. In Long Island’s Nassau County, gun violence was reduced by a whopping 90 percent at the close of this year’s first quarter. . . .
The subscription-based implementation called ShotSpotter Flex costs as much as $60,000 per square mile. . . .
